Coming from 2-1 down in the best of 5 series, the Phoenix Mercury have accounted for the Indiana Fever 3-2.

Australia's Penny Taylor played a pivotal role in the Mercury's win over compatriot Tully Bevilacqua's Fever.

Taylor has 14 points, 4 rebounds and 5 assists in 24min coming off the bench after returning mid-way through the season from ankle surgery.

Bevilacqua had 3 points and 3 assisted in 16min.
